According to Fact.MR, The global sales of aesthetic medicine market in 2021 was held at US$ 64.6 billion. With 10.3%, the projected market growth during 2022 – 2032 is expected to be significantly higher than the historical growth.

The Asia-Pacific region is expected to witness the highest growth rate in the aesthetic medicine market due to the increasing adoption of aesthetic treatments in countries such as China, Japan, and South Korea. The region is expected to account for a significant share of the global aesthetic medicine market during the forecast period. North America and Europe are also expected to witness significant growth due to the presence of major players in the region and the increasing demand for aesthetic treatments. The key players operating in the aesthetic medicine market include Allergan, Galderma, Merz Pharma, Valeant Pharmaceuticals International, Alma Lasers, Cynosure, Lumenis, and Syneron Medical. How is Product and Procedure Innovation Fuelling the Medical Aesthetics Market’s Expansion?

Product and procedure innovation are playing a crucial role in fueling the expansion of the medical aesthetics market. The market is witnessing significant investment in research and development activities, leading to the development of advanced products and procedures. For instance, the development of dermal fillers that can be used for a wide range of aesthetic treatments has led to the growth of the market. Similarly, the development of new laser and light-based devices for skin rejuvenation, hair removal, and body contouring is also driving the growth of the market. The development of non-invasive and minimally invasive procedures is also expected to boost the growth of the market as they offer several advantages over traditional surgical procedures, including shorter recovery times and reduced risks of complications.

In addition to product and procedure innovation, technological advancements are also playing a key role in the growth of the medical aesthetics market. For instance, the development of 3D imaging technology is enabling physicians to provide more accurate and personalized treatments to patients. Similarly, the use of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) in aesthetic medicine is leading to the development of advanced treatment options that offer better results. The use of vir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) in patient consultations is also expected to boost the growth of the market by improving patient engagement and satisfaction. These advancements are driving the growth of the medical aesthetics market and are expected to continue to do so in the coming years.

What Is the Influence of Celebrity Promoting Aesthetic Medicine Treatments?

The influence of celebrity promoting aesthetic medicine treatments cannot be denied in today’s society. Celebrities are seen as trendsetters and role models, and their endorsement of certain aesthetic treatments can create a significant impact on the demand for these treatments. Many celebrities openly share their experiences with cosmetic treatments on social media, making it more acceptable and normalized for the general public. This has led to an increase in demand for treatments such as dermal fillers, Botox injections, and non-surgical facelifts.

However, the influence of celebrity endorsement of aesthetic treatments has also led to concerns about the impact on the general public’s body image and self-esteem. It can create unrealistic expectations and pressure to conform to a certain beauty standard. The use of social media filters and editing tools has also contributed to this issue, leading to an increased demand for aesthetic treatments. This has led to a debate about the ethical implications of promoting aesthetic treatments to impressionable audiences, especially young people. As such, it is essential to strike a balance between promoting aesthetic treatments and ensuring that patients are fully informed and aware of the potential risks and benefits of these treatments.
